Centre de la Petite Enfance les Petits Anges is a charitable organization based in Pointe-Claire, Quebec, classified by the CRA under community resource organizations. It appears on the charity register the way hospitals, universities, and other publicly funded bodies do — to issue tax receipts — rather than as a donation-driven charity in the usual sense. In its fiscal year ending March 31, 2024, it reported $1.3M in revenue and $1.4M in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 75% from government. Government funding is the majority of its budget. In 2024,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$41.

Compared with 829 community-service institutions of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 5% of peers. Its fundraising cost per donated dollar was lower than 100% of that peer group. Its highest-paid position fell in the $80,000–119,999 range. The charity reported 13 permanent full-time positions.

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 8 names.

In its own words

Centre de la Petite Enfance recevant 60 enfants entre 3 mois et 5 ans - Soins et éducation des jeunes enfants - Intégrer des enfants ayant des besoins particuliers - Recevoir et guider des stagiaires - Offrir des formations à notre personnel - Organiser des événements spéciaux pour les enfants et les familles - Accueillir adulte avec besoins particuliers dans l'équipe de travail.

Ongoing-program description from its T3010 filing, verbatim.
